I ran into the same problem trying to upgrade my Y570 WiFi adapter. FRUs listed in the Hardware manual seem to be non-existant. Lenovo support first informed me that the adaptor was intigrated and non upgradable. After almost an hour I think he finally relented and transferred me to parts (which was closed). On the second call after I offered return my laptop he came back and said that he could supply the card for $386 (half of what I paid for the laptop).

I returned to Ebay and found the following listing from dealer "iornament" for $33.99 from China :

"Intel Wifi/Wimax Link 6250 IBM Thinkpad Lenovo ANX N Wireless half pci-e card"

The card is a model: 622ANXHMW with a FRU P/N: 60Y3195.

The card arrived yesterday (15 days after ordering). The installation last night was simple. I didn't have time for much testing, but it seems that after updating drivers that everything is working perfectly.
